We just released our 2024-2025 annual report, which demonstrates how UVA’s Asian and Asian Pacific American Alumni Network (AAPAAN) remained dedicated to its mission of establishing a network that fosters connections and provides support for Asian alumni within the University of Virginia community.

Our engagement committee, led by Sanjeev Kumar (Com class of ’23, Col class of ’23), has been highly active this year. We recap and preview some events in this newsletter, and go into even more depth in our annual report. The committee has organized various events throughout the year, primarily in the Washington, D.C. metropolitan area, with a couple in New York City. We’ve also held events for our Hoos who have settled in Boston, Atlanta, and Los Angeles.
